The Supreme Court on Monday asked the Centre to set up a committee to look into steps to be taken to curb incidents of ragging in colleges and universities.

A Bench headed by Justice Arijit Pasayat asked the concerned ministry to constitute a committee on the lines of one which recently came out with a slew of steps to curb violence and use of money power in the elections to university student unions.
The court has granted the Centre a period of three weeks to take action in this regard.
A committee headed by former chief election commissioner JM Lyngdoh had recommended several measures to curb it.
